I'm looking for pollarded versions of this willow tree, which are commonly used in long rows alongside water ditches in the Dutch countryside.
I can't find them in the workshop. Do they exist, and if so, does anyone have a link?
If you search for images of "knotwilgen" you'll see what I mean, e.g. in this search result:
https://duckduckgo.com/?q=knotwilg&t=h_&iax=images&ia=images
The trees get all their branches cut off once every 3-6 years, so they can have different lengths and densities of branches, but a medium-density mop would be ideal, like this one has:
